About this seed

Why gardeners choose this variety

Coralwood's brightly colored seeds have a history beyond the garden. The red seeds of Adenanthera pavonina have been used as beads and, historically, as small weights. Their polished appearance contrasts with the curled pods that release them, making the tree a memorable example of the relationship between plants, ornament and everyday materials.

The living tree is a substantial tropical landscape plant with finely divided foliage. Where the climate and available space are suitable, it can be studied as a specimen rather than crowded into a small border. The seeds offered here are for propagation, not eating. A growing collection also provides a useful place to observe pod development and prevent seedlings from spreading beyond the intended planting.

Growing tips

A stronger start

  • Sow in a free-draining mix and maintain steady warmth.
  • Keep the medium moist without saturation while roots establish.
  • Protect seedlings from cold and acclimatize them to stronger light gradually.
  • Treat as an ornamental plant; keep plant material and seeds away from food, children and pets.
